This gravel cycling route showcases the diverse landscapes and hidden gems of Kent. With a total ascent of 651m and a distance of 68km, it offers an enjoyable ride for gravel enthusiasts. Highlights along the route include the picturesque village of Lydden, the historic Castle Hill, and the charming town of Hythe. The route also takes you through the scenic village of Sellindge and the quaint village of Barham, offering a chance to immerse yourself in the natural beauty of the area. The route concludes in Eythorne, where you can unwind and appreciate the rural surroundings.

LyddenVillage
Discover Lydden, a small village known for its motorsport history. Take a moment to visit the Lydden Hill Race Circuit and learn about its rich heritage.
Castle Hill126 mPeak
Explore Castle Hill, an ancient fortress that dates back to the Iron Age. Marvel at the picturesque views from the top and imagine the historical events that have unfolded here.
HytheTown
Cycle through Hythe and enjoy its charming seaside atmosphere. Take a stroll along the promenade or visit the historic Hythe Military Cemetery, the resting place of World War II soldiers.
SellindgeVillage
Pass through Sellindge, a village surrounded by beautiful countryside and picturesque views. Take a moment to appreciate the tranquility and natural beauty of the area.
BarhamVillage
Cycle through Barham, a historic village nestled in the Kent Downs Area of Outstanding Natural Beauty. Admire the traditional architecture and enjoy the peaceful surroundings.
